A Brief History and the Evolution of the Datejust

The Rolex Datejust, first introduced in 1945, was revolutionary for its time. It was the first self-winding wristwatch to display the date in a window at 3 o'clock – a seemingly simple feature that significantly enhanced functionality and user experience. This innovation, combined with Rolex's unwavering commitment to precision and durability, quickly established the Datejust as a benchmark in horology.

Over the decades, the Datejust has undergone subtle yet significant evolutions, adapting to changing tastes and technological advancements. The case size, bezel styles, dial variations, and bracelet options have all seen modifications, resulting in a diverse range of models catering to individual preferences. The Rolex Datejust 4: A Detailed Look

The Rolex Datejust 4, as mentioned, boasts a 41mm case size, a significant increase from earlier iterations. This larger size caters to the modern preference for more substantial wristwatches, while still maintaining the classic Datejust proportions. The case, meticulously crafted from Oystersteel or precious metals like 18ct yellow, white, or Everose gold, is renowned for its robustness and water resistance.

The bezel is another key design element. Depending on the specific model, the Datejust 4 can feature a fluted bezel, a smooth bezel, or a bezel set with diamonds or other precious stones. The fluted bezel, a signature element of the Datejust, adds a touch of elegance and sophistication, while the smooth bezel offers a more understated aesthetic.
